EzzyRallyBoy Posted July 3, 2009 Share Posted July 3, 2009 Right latest update - My car is in and is going through its PDI (Pre-Delivery Inspection), being taxed, having number plates fitted today as well as being valeted, so they said it will be available for collection tomorrow (Saturday) afternoon - hoooorahhhh (providing nothing goes wrong eh !!!!) So, just for the record that is exactly 8 weeks, from order to collection, for a Black 1.6 petrol 3 door Titanium with no extras, apparently built in Cologne By my calculations it took something like 5 & 1/2 weeks until "Build completion" from "Initial Order", then a further 1 week before it was transported to the Port of Vlissingen (Holland) - the dealer referred to it being ready for "Outboard transportation" in Belgium (unless its on the Holland / Belgium border dunno not checked), then about another 1 week passed before it was "In the UK awaiting Customs Clearance" then about 5 days until "Ready for Collection" at the dealership Hope that helps someone in their wait !!!!!!!!!!
